The iPhone camera is a pretty crappy deal. My 3G model only has 2mp of resolution, no focus, not very good dynamic range, and a bad lens. Despite this, iPhone photography is amazingly popular. Some pro photographers have even published books of nothing but iPhone photos. Part of the reason for this popularity is the [...]

All about Torii Gates

Let’s talk about torii (toh-ree) gates. Most people know them by sight and know they are Japanese, but not much more. Is there anything more? Lots! Photo by Kevin Jaako You will only find torii gates at Shinto shrines, not at Buddhist temples1. The purpose of the gate is to divide our world and the [...]
